Marlboro Hills, Originally Known as Racuh-A-Payaman
When you say Batanes, Marlboro Hills always comes up to everyone’s mind. It is the iconic hills and ocean view in Batanes. Japanese Tunnel, Basco Batanes
Batanes was not spared from the war back in the 1940s. Ivatans were forced to create this Japanese tunnels through the hill so the Japanese military can hide.
